> Everything that Mark says is true. I'll add that some shops optimize
> their read operations under certain conditions, and such optimizations
> would break if the RCS files are updated in-place.
>
> What happens is that, if the version of every file can be identified in
> advance (using version number, tag, or branch/timestamp pair) then they
> can invoke RCS directly to fetch file versions, read metadata, and so
> on. This sidesteps CVS' overhead and can increase performance by as
So are these tricks *never* performed by cvs itself? i.e. would my
trick (if I can solve the interrupted write case) be completely
safe with any use of cvs as long as you didn't access the files
externally?
